Properties
- Physical Form
- Physical Properties
Value Units Test Method / Conditions Density 1.12 - ASTM D792 Melt Mass Flow Rate (at 250°C, 11.6 kg) 25 - 50 g/10 min ASTM D1238 Molding Shrinkage (at 0.125 in, Flow) 6.0E-3 to 9.0E-3 in/in ASTM D955 Molding Shrinkage (at 0.125 in, Across Flow) 6.0E-3 to 9.0E-3 in/in ASTM D955 Specific Gravity 1.12 - ASTM D792 - Mechanical Properties
Value Units Test Method / Conditions Tensile Strength (at Yield, 0.125 in) 9200 psi ASTM D638 Tensile Strength (at Break, 0.125 in) 9000 psi ASTM D638 Flexural Modulus (at 0.125 in) 460000 psi ASTM D790 Flexural Strength (at Break, 0.125 in) 12000 psi ASTM D790 - Thermal Properties
Value Units Test Method / Conditions Deflection Temperature Under Load (at 66 psi, 0.125 in, Unannealed) 220 °F ASTM D648 Deflection Temperature Under Load (at 264 psi, 0.125 in, Unannealed) 210 °F ASTM D648 Relative Thermal Index Electrical Property (at 0.12 in) 149 °F UL 746 Relative Thermal Index Electrical Property (at 0.15 in) 149 °F UL 746 Relative Thermal Index Impact Property (at 0.12 in) 149 °F UL 746 Relative Thermal Index Impact Property (at 0.15 in) 149 °F UL 746 Relative Thermal Index Strength Property (at 0.12 in) 149 °F UL 746 Relative Thermal Index Strength Property (at 0.15 in) 149 °F UL 746 - Flammability
Value Units Test Method / Conditions Flame Rating (at 0.12 in) V-0 - UL 94 Flame Rating (at 0.15 in) V-0, 5VA - UL 94 - Processing Information (Injection Molding)
Value Units Test Method / Conditions Drying Temperature 160 - 180 °F - Drying Time 3.0 - 4.0 hr - Front Temperature 520 - 580 °F - Middle Temperature 520 - 580 °F - Mold Temperature 100 - 180 °F - Rear Temperature 450 - 500 °F - Maximum Drying Time 8 hr - Processing Temperature (Melt) 500 - 550 °F - - Impact Properties
Value Units Test Method / Conditions Impact Strength (at 0.125 in, Notched Izod) 2 ft·lb/in ASTM D256 Gardner Impact Strength (at 0.125 in) 150 in·lb ASTM D3029 - Hardness
Value Units Test Method / Conditions Rockwell Hardness (R-Scale) 121 - ASTM D785
